A series of prearranged glycosides 4, 9, 14, 16, 22, 28, 33, 41, and 46, having a benzyl-protected 1-thiomannosyl donor linked through its position 6 via malonate and succinate tethers to various positions of glucosamine, galactose, mannose, and rhamnose accepters, were prepared and cyclized to the corresponding disaccharides. The configuration at the anomeric center of the products strongly depended on the position of the tt ther in the acceptor part and could be predicted from the calculated thermodynamic stability of the products. No strong dependence of the diastereoselectivity of the intramolecular glycosylations on the activation conditions and the solvent was observed.
